What is the most famous snack in Sichuan?

1, Dandan Noodles, Sichuan

Dandan Noodles is widely spread in Sichuan, and is rated as "one of the top ten noodles in China". The origin of Dandan Noodles is small noodles bought with a shoulder pole. Later, when he became famous, he became Dandan Noodles. It can be said that almost no one in Sichuan does not know about Dandan Noodles. This noodle is red and bright in color, fragrant in winter vegetable sesame sauce, hot and sour, fresh but not greasy, spicy but not dry, and can be called the best in Sichuan pasta.

2. Zhong jiaozi

Zhong jiaozi, an authentic Sichuan traditional snack, began in the 19th year of Guangxu (1893). Because it was located in Litchi Lane at the beginning of its opening, it was heavily seasoned with red oil, so it was also called "jiaozi with Red Oil in Litchi Lane". Compared with ordinary dumplings, Zhong Tangyuan is filled with pork stuffing and thinner than ordinary dumplings without other fresh vegetables. Moreover, Zhong jiaozi eats it with special soy sauce and red oil, and can only eat it dry.

3. Dragon wonton soup

"Chaoshou" is a local name for wonton in Sichuan. Because the wrapped wonton looks like a person holding hands, it is named "Chaoshou". In other places outside Sichuan, wonton has always been cooked in clear soup and occasionally fried. But only in Sichuan, piles of pepper and pepper oil were added to a heavy-flavored red oil wonton. Among them, the abnormal "Ma Lao Wonton" will definitely make you lose your mouth when you eat the third one. But it is precisely because of this extreme taste that people who love it will love it and those who are afraid of it will avoid it.

6. Fushun tofu pudding

There are many delicious tofu pudding in Sichuan, but Fushun is the most famous. Fushun bean curd consists of rice, bean curd and dipped in water. All three are indispensable. Among them, tofu brain dipped in water is the key, and it must be made of Bazin sea pepper, sesame oil, soybean oil, garlic paste and big fish fragrance, which is very distinctive.

7. Yibin burning noodles

To say burning noodles is the most distinctive traditional snack in Yibin area. Yibin burning noodles, formerly known as Xufu burning noodles, were called fried dough sticks noodles a long time ago. Why is it called burning noodles? Because the seasoning used to make noodles is oily and heavy, and there is no water. It is said that ignition can burn, so it is called burning noodles. There are countless burning noodles in the street. A bowl of Yibin burning noodles in the morning is refreshing.

8.bow chicken

Ji Bo is a characteristic snack person in Leshan. At first, it was made of chicken, chicken gizzards, chicken skin and chicken feet. Put it in a bowl and soak it with spicy seasoning, hence the name. Nowadays, everyone is not shy. As long as it flies in the sky, runs underground, swims in the water and grows in the ground, it can be made into Ji Bo.

Here, I want to say that chicken is not a cold pot string. Although there is no difference between the two in the picture, the cold pot skewers are cooked skewers, put into a large pot without "fire" and soaked in hot soup, so they are actually hot; And Huayuan chicken is to put the pre-fried soup in a bowl and serve it, and soak the pre-made kebabs in it before eating, so it is actually cold!

6. Firewhip Beef

Firewhip beef originated in Qianlong period of Qing Dynasty, and became a famous specialty in Sichuan in the late Qing Dynasty and early Republic of China. Together with Zhang Fei beef and Taihe beef, it is also called "Sichuan Sanjue Beef". Fire whip beef is a traditional specialty of Han nationality in Du Yan (Zigong, Sichuan), which is famous for its high quality, delicious taste, thin sheet like paper, crispy and long. Huobianzi beef originated in the Qing Dynasty and has a history of more than 200 years. Strict material selection, fine knife work, exquisite craftsmanship, unique flavor, smooth fragrance and long aftertaste.

7.lizhuang white meat

Lizhuang white meat, full name "Lizhuang knife-edge garlic white meat", is a traditional Han cuisine in Lizhuang, a famous historical and cultural town in Yibin, Sichuan. The pork from Changbai Mountain, York or Basha is used as raw material, with thin skin and tender meat, suitable oil and fat ratio, and various sauces, which are fragrant and refreshing, fat but not greasy and chewy.

8. Luojiang bean chicken

This dish is a famous vegetarian dish in Luojiang County, Sichuan Province. Soybean is used as the main raw material and ground into soybean milk. Make it into oil skin, wrap it in sesame powder and steam it. The color is brownish yellow, soft and dry, salty and fresh.

Fire Whip Beef Fire Whip Beef originated in the Qianlong period of the Qing Dynasty and became a famous specialty in Sichuan in the late Qing Dynasty and the early Republic of China. Together with Zhang Fei beef and Taihe beef, it is also called "Sichuan Sanjue Beef". It is famous for its high quality, delicious taste, thin sheet like paper, crispy and long. Fire whip is an ancient lighting torch in Zigong, Sichuan. Here, the brightness of the "lamp" is used to indicate the thinness and transparency of beef.
